It's not typical for your cooking area sink to clog up several times in one month. If your sink obstructs twice a week, there's some problem going on.
A blocked cooking area drain doesn't just slow down your duties, it weakens your entire plumbing system, little by little. Right here are some usual practices that motivate sink clogs, and exactly how to prevent them.

You need proper waste disposal


Recycling waste is excellent, but do you take note of your organic waste also? Your kitchen ought to have 2 different waste boxes; one for recyclable plastics and also another for organic waste, which can end up being compost.
Having an assigned trash can will certainly aid you and your family prevent tossing pasta and also other food remnants down the drain. Usually, these residues soak up dampness as well as end up being blockages.

Somebody attempted to wash their hair in the cooking area sink


There's a right time as well as area for every little thing. The kitchen sink is just not the best location to wash your hair. Washing your hair in the kitchen sink will certainly make it obstruct one way or another unless you make use of a drainpipe catcher.
While a drain catcher may catch most of the fallouts, some strands might still survive. If you have thick hair, this may suffice to reduce your drain as well as ultimately form a clog.

You're tossing coffee away


Utilized coffee grounds and also coffee beans still take in a significant amount of dampness. They might appear small sufficient to throw down the drainpipe, however as time goes on they begin to swell and take up more space.
Your coffee premises ought to go into natural garbage disposal. Whatever fraction escapes (probably while you're depleting) will be taken care of throughout your regular monthly clean-up.

You have actually been consuming a great deal of greasy foods


Your kitchen area sink may still obtain obstructed despite organic waste disposal. This may be due to the fact that you have a diet regimen rich in greasy foods like cheeseburgers.
This grease layers the insides of pipes, making them narrower and also even more clog-prone.

Your pipeline wasn't dealt with effectively to begin with


If you've been doing none of the above, but still get regular obstructions in your kitchen area sink, you should certainly call a plumber. There could be a problem with just how your pipes were mounted.
While your plumber shows up, check for any leakages or irregularities around your kitchen pipelines. Don't attempt to deal with the pipelines on your own. This may create a mishap or a kitchen flooding.

There's more dust than your pipelines can handle


If you obtain fruits directly from a farm, you may see more cooking area dirt than other individuals that shop from a shopping center. You can conveniently fix this by cleaning up the fruits and also veggies correctly prior to bringing them into your house.

Melt the sludge


  • 1. Pour one-half mug baking soft drink right into the drain complied with by one-half cup white vinegar; the fizzy as well as bubbling response helps to separate small blockages.

  • 2. Block the drainpipe using a little rag so the chemical reaction does not all bubble up out.

  • 3. Wait 15 minutes.

  • 4. Now put a pot's worth of boiling water down the drainpipe and run hot water for a number of mins to further clear out the melted scum.

    5 Things to Do if You Want to Unclog Your Kitchen Sink


    Trick 1: Don’t Put Vegetable Peelings Down Disposal



    Although the garbage disposal is a powerful and useful way to get rid of food waste, it is not meant for certain vegetables. Don’t put potato, carrot or celery peelings down the disposal. These veggies are fibrous or contain a lot of starch which can jam the disposal motor and clog your sink drain-piping every time. There are other food items that occasionally will clog your sink. If this happens, follow the next four tips.


    Trick 2: Use Your Plunger


    Plunger is a must-have tool for every household because it can be used to unclog any drain in any part of the house including the kitchen. Yes, the simple plunger can unclog your kitchen sink too. When you use the plunger, plug the other holes in you kitchen sink with a rag cloth. Also, ensure that the plunger cup completely covers the clogged kitchen sink hole. Now, keep the plunger in an upright position and plunge about ten times vigorously. This should remove any vegetable peels, food leftovers or any other solids in the kitchen sink.


    Trick 3: Clear the P-trap


    The P-trap is the pipe below your sink that’s shaped like the letter P (on its side). You should be able to spot it when you look in the cabinet below your sink. This pipe, shaped to provide a seal against sewer odors, gets clogged when receiving larger solid objects. To unclog the P-trap, you need a pair of gloves and a bucket. You should unscrew the large nut on both the sides of the trap with your bare hands and remove the pipe. Make sure you place a bucket right below the trap to collect all the unclogged water. You can also run your hands through the pipe to remove any solid objects.


    Trick 4: Use a Metal Wire


    Sometimes using a metal wire to push down or pull up debris from your drain can help unclog your kitchen sink. If you don’t have a metal wire, unbend a wire hanger and use it in the kitchen drain hole. Since this is time-consuming, you’d only use this trick as a last resort. It works well when you know what’s inside the drain.


    Trick 5: Use a Drain Snake


    Go to your local hardware store and buy a short manual-crank drain snake. This tool is fairly inexpensive and works well unless the clog is further down the drain, past the P-trap.



    If none of the above tricks work, then you should call an expert right away, especially since clogged drains are the perfect breeding ground for all kinds of bacteria and viruses.
